Unrelated to UConn though it may be, Ernie Banks has died and we are all diminished by his loss. The angry and annoyed, the irritated and irate, will say this post has no business being in the ‘Boneyard’. Perhaps. But I would disagree. Mr. Banks was a ballplayer for the Chicago Cubs, if you did not know. He was a great ballplayer - Hall of Fame caliber - on mostly bad teams. Yet the Hall of Fame was the least of his accomplishments: He was a great human being. I never liked the Cubs. Still don’t. I always loved Ernie Banks. As I said, we are all diminished by his loss. The world in which we live needs more men like Mr. Banks, not fewer. Godspeed.
“Let’s play two.” Ernie Banks
